Looking for a very good to excellent "porsche" reflector for a friend. His has warped and he's set on replacing it. If you have one available, please PM me the condition and price. Pics would be great too.

They did not have holes for the lock. The 911 version has to have the ends cut off to fit between the tail lights. 914 version fits.
